About the project

The objective of HOMBAT is to contribute to the prevention & combating of homophobia and transphobia (HT) in Greece (GR), Cyprus(CY) and Lithuania (LT). In particular, HOMBAT will:

  • Promote and strengthen the prevention and tackling of HT bullying in schools;
  • Build the capacities of teachers and school advisors on preventing and addressing HT bullying;
  • Enhance multi-actor cooperation and exchange on combating HT bullying in schools;
  • Raise awareness about HT bullying in the educational environment and support prevention through counter narratives development and promotion;

HOMBAT is mainly targeted at:

  • school advisors & other school professionals at primary/secondary level
  • teachers at primary/secondary level
  • students in primary/secondary education
  • parents of primary/secondary students
  • educational authorities, civil society & other professionals

By the end of the project, it is expected to:

  • Enhance capacities & knowledge of teachers & school advisors/professionals on preventing & addressing HT bullying
  • Strengthen multi-actor cooperation & exchange on combating HT bullying in schools
  • Increase awareness about HT bullying in the educational environment & change of attitudes of students, parents, teachers, school advisors & professionals.

The Project is funded by the European Commission and will run for 24 months (October 2017 – September 2019).
